收藏
回答

安卓手机页面使用location.href跳转成功之后页面的点击事件失效?

function(res){
            console.log(res.err_msg)    
            if(res.err_msg == "get_brand_wcpay_request:ok" ){
            // 使用以上方式判断前端返回,微信团队郑重提示:    
            //res.err_msg将在用户支付成功后返回ok,但并不保证它绝对可靠。     
            window.location.href = `http://youbesunstore-test.youbesun.com/#/paysuccess?goodsId=${goodsId}&angencyCode=${angencyCode}&paysuccessorderId=${orderId}&paysuccesstotalorderId=${orderNum}&session=${session}`
            }else if(res.err_msg == "get_brand_wcpay_request:cancel" ){
                console.log('取消了')
            }else if(res.err_msg == "get_brand_wcpay_request:fail" ){
                console.log('失败')
            }
        }
        
传输数据过去之后页面可以正常展示,但是上面的点击事件就失效了。不知道什么原因。
然后我点击了安卓手机自带的返回按钮之后页面的事件就生效了,求大神帮忙看下是什么问题怎么解决呀。
IOS都是正常的没问题,就安卓出现了。
我换了touch也不行。


回答关注问题邀请回答
收藏

1 个回答

  • 社区技术运营专员-娇华
    社区技术运营专员-娇华
    2020-05-11

    你好,麻烦提供以下信息:

    1、复现问题的链接,复现流程

    2、复现的微信号、时间点

    2020-05-11
    有用
    回复 5
    • 桶桶、
      桶桶、
      2020-05-12
      出现问题的链接在下面,就是在支付成功,通过微信支付成功回调函数跳转到下面的链接的时候,只有安卓机出现无法点击的情况。付款的微信号是:jayrisa;时间是2020.5.11 14:36
      2020-05-12
      回复
    • 社区技术运营专员-娇华
      社区技术运营专员-娇华
      2020-05-12回复桶桶、
      是必现的么,出现问题的机型是多少,还有微信版本
      2020-05-12
      回复
    • 桶桶、
      桶桶、
      2020-05-12回复社区技术运营专员-娇华
      对,必定出现,换了几个手机都有这个问题,不知道什么原因。微信上所有的都无法点击,只能点击安卓手机自带的返回键。
      版本是:7.014
      2020-05-12
      回复
    • 桶桶、
      桶桶、
      2020-05-21
      有结果了吗?
      2020-05-21
      回复
    • 微信技术专员-Abe
      微信技术专员-Abe
      2020-05-26回复桶桶、
      看看7.0.15还有问题吗?70.14 webview这里有一些bug, 7.0.15 fix了
      2020-05-26
      回复
登录 后发表内容
问题标签